The CBU Safe Zone Program supports LGBTQIA (l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, queer or questioning, inter-sexed, asexual or ally) students. Safe Zones provide supportive and confidential spaces for any student to be heard, get resources, and feel safe. Safe Zones are marked with the Safe Zone logo and a certificate confirming Safe Zone Allies' completion of Safe Zone training.
